This Year 3 Speech Marks worksheet pack helps children learn how to punctuate direct speech correctly using speech marks (inverted commas), commas, capital letters, question marks and exclamation marks.

The pack is fully differentiated to support all learners and is ideal for classwork, homework, interventions or revision.

What’s included:

  • Triangles (Support):
    Add missing speech marks and punctuation; rewrite simple sentences with support.

  • Circles (Core):
    Identify and correct two errors in each sentence; rewrite sentences using correct punctuation.

  • Squares (Challenge):
    Rewrite longer sentences with embedded clauses, write dialogue responses, and create their own correctly punctuated speech.

Skills covered:

  • Using speech marks (inverted commas)

  • Capital letters in direct speech

  • Commas before closing speech marks

  • Question marks and exclamation marks

  • Reporting verbs (said, asked, shouted, whispered)

  • Editing and proofreading sentences

  • Writing dialogue correctly
